Essays on Handel and Italian Opera

Discover the intricate connections between Handel's operas and the rich tapestry of the European Baroque tradition in Essays on Handel and Italian Opera by Reinhard Strohm. Published by Cambridge University Press in 2008, this insightful collection of essays delves into the profound influence of the Italian school on Handel's masterpieces. Spanning 316 pages, Strohm's work not only celebrates the tercentenary of Handel's birth but also provides a deeper understanding of how these operas were shaped by their historical context.
